لوحة المتصدرين
المحتوى الأكثر حصولًا على سمعة جيدة
المحتوى الأعلى تقييمًا في 11/09/22 in أجوبة
-
مرحبا ضمن مشروع دجانغو احتاج الى الحصول على موقع المستخدم عند التسجيل (خطوط الطول والعرض ) وحفظها في قاعدة البيانات حاولت العمل على PointField() class Clinic(Center): name_doctor = models.CharField(_("Name_Doctor:"),max_length=50) working_hours = models.CharField(_("working_hours:"),max_length=50,unique=False) waiting_time = models.IntegerField(_("waiting_time"), unique=True) price = models.IntegerField(_("Price is"), unique=True) slug = models.SlugField(_("slug") ) location = models.PointField() def save(self, **kwargs): if not self.location: address = u'%s %s %s %s %s %s' % (self.a2, self.a3, self.a4, self.a5, self.a6, self.pcode) address = address.encode('utf-8') geocoder = GoogleV3(api_key='My API Key') try: _, latlon = geocoder.geocode(address, timeout=10) except (URLError, ValueError, TypeError): pass else: point = "POINT(%s %s)" % (latlon[1], latlon[0]) self.location = geos.fromstr(point) super(Architect, self).save() هل هذه الطريقة مناسبة ام يوجد طريقة افضل1 نقطة
-
1 نقطة
-
1 نقطة
-
حاول أن تبحث في google عن العنوان التالي ستجد الكثير من الخيارات التي تساعدك على اكتشاف وحل المشكلة Cross-Browser Testing Tools1 نقطة
-
شكرا بش مهندس مسعود هلأ لما اعمل run بعمل لل project الاول كيف بدي اخليه يعمل لل project الثاني1 نقطة
-
هل هناك مصدر لأراجعه من أجل التنسيق حسب أنظمة التشغيل وكيف أعرف الخصائص المدعومة و غير المدعومة للأنظمة المشهورة ؟1 نقطة
-
توجد مكتبة مشهورة لتحميل مقاطع اليوتيوب ، pytube يغطي هذا الدليل أبسط استخدامات المكتبة. لمزيد من المعلومات التفصيلية ، يرجى الرجوع إلى pytube.io. تثبيت الحزمة أو المكتبة python -m pip install pytube لتنزيل مقطع فيديو باستخدام المكتبة في برنامج نصي ، ستحتاج إلى استيراد فصل YouTube من المكتبة وتمرير وسيطة لعنوان URL للفيديو. من هناك ، يمكنك الوصول إلى التدفقات وتنزيلها. >>> from pytube import YouTube >>> YouTube('https://youtu.be/2lAe1cqCOXo').streams.first().download() >>> yt = YouTube('http://youtube.com/watch?v=2lAe1cqCOXo') >>> yt.streams ... .filter(progressive=True, file_extension='mp4') ... .order_by('resolution') ... .desc() ... .first() ... .download() بالنسبة لتيكتوك أنصحك بالحزمة TikTokApi1 نقطة
-
تعلمت اطار عمل vue js و vue cli اريد تطبيقات عملية فهل اجد لديكم افكار او مواقع تدلني على بعض المشاريع او التطبيقات العملية بهذا الاطار ؟1 نقطة
-
الأمر بسيط ، تقوم بتحميل الحزم django-rest-sms-auth و twilio pip install django-rest-sms-auth twilio ثم تسجيلها في الإعدادات INSTALLED_APPS = [ 'django.contrib.admin', 'django.contrib.auth', ... 'sms_auth', 'sms_auth.providers.twilio' ] SMS_AUTH_SETTINGS = { "SMS_CELERY_FILE_NAME": "run_celery", # ملف celery ، "SMS_AUTH_SUCCESS_KEY": "jwt_token", "SMS_AUTH_PROVIDER_FROM": "ex: +7542222222", # رقم الهاتف # If twilio "SMS_AUTH_ACCOUNT_SID": "Twilio SID" "SMS_AUTH_AUTH_TOKEN": "Twilio token" } ثم اعمل تهجير البيانات python manage.py makemigrations sms_auth && python manage.py migrate ملف urls path('auth/', include('sms_auth.api.urls')) طريقة التحقق : POST /auth/auth/ body: { "phone_number":"user phone number", "code":sms_code } result: 200/400 response (with token)1 نقطة
-
انا اعرف أنه يمكنك بناء أي واجهة أمامية باستخدام الـ vue js وهنالك الكثير من افكار المواقع الالكترونية (واجهات امامية) : صفحة هبوط لمنتج معين صفحة سيتم اطلاق الموقع بعد كذا ..إلخ. صفحة الصفحة غير موجودة 404. لوحة تحكم لموقع ويب. موقع ويب عن السياحة والسفر موقع ويب عن الرياضة موقع ويب عن الأخبار موقع ويب أسئلة وأجوبة ويمكنك الاطلاع على السؤال التالي :1 نقطة
-
في اي اطار عمل او اي لغة او اي اداة يجب عليك دائما ان تنفذ مايتكرر في المواقع بشكل عام مثلا ، ماذا يتكرر بالعادة: تسجيل الدخول والخروج، عمليات ال Crud اي الانشاء والحذف والتعديل والقراءة فيجب عليك هنا ان تطبق عليهم باستعمال Vue ولكن ليس فقط كشكل انما اقصد ايضا كاستقبال المعلومات من قواعد البيانات وارسالها الى قواعد البيانات وايضا عمليات تسجيل الدخول والخروج (Auth) امثلة عملية: لوحة تحكم وربطها بموقع ، تسجيل الدخول والخروج الى لوحة التحكم ، تسجيل الدخول والخروج الى الموقع والتحكم بواجهة الموقع وشكلها وتنسيقها عن طريق لوحة التحكم يمكنك ايضا عمل مذكرة بدون الحاجة الى قواعد بيانات ، وانما تطبيق عمل ال Localstorage الفكرة هي انك يجب عليك تطبيق ماهو متكرر بالمواقع ومايستعمله الناس بكثرة1 نقطة
-
يمكنك الاستفادة من الحلول المطروحة على نفس السؤال:1 نقطة
-
بخصوص إختلاف التجاوب على المتصفحات فيجب الأخذ بنظر الإعتبار عند كتابة css أن تكون أكوادك تدعم كافة المتصفحات الشائعة popular بما معناه تستطيع تحديد المشكلة من خلال معرفة نوع المتصفح الذي ظهرت به المشكلة وإصداره وكذلك النظام التشغيلي حيث أن بعض الخصائص لنفس نوع المتصفح قد تعمل على وندوز ولكن ليس على ios على سبيل المثال. بخصوص أخطاء جافاسكربت نحتاج صورة الشاشة للأخطاء الذي ظهرت في console حتى نساعدك في حل المشكلة.1 نقطة
-
يمكنك بناء أي شيء بواسطة django و لكن بالطبع لو أن هناك إطار عمل واحد لكل شيء و كان الأفضل فلا داعي لوجود البقية، من هذا المنطلق فإن هناك بعض المواقع التي قد تجد فيها أن django أسهل بكثير. في حال كان تطبيقك بسيط جداً فقد تجد من الأسهل استعمال مكاتب أو أطر عمل مصغرة مثل Flask فهي أسهل و أسرع في حال كان تطبيقك صغير، و لكن هذا لا يعني أنك لا تستطيع بناءه بواسطة django، و إن هذا يعتمد على خبرتك. أفضل طريقة لترى إمكانيات إطار عمل هو أن ترى بعض المشاريع التي تم بناءها باستعمال هذا الإطار، من أجل django بعض أشهر المشاريع و التطبيقات هي: Instagram Spotify Pinterest Bitbucket National Geographic YouTube Google Search Engine يمكنك الذهاب إلى هذه المواقع و رؤية ما قاموا به لتعرف ما يمكنك عمله بواسطة django. من ناحية تعلم أكثر من إطار عمل فهذا جيد طبعاً، حيث أن ذلك يسمح لك باختيار أفضل إطار عمل بالنسبة للمشروع الذي ستقوم ببناءه، و لكن بالطبع يمكنك بناء أي موقع ولو أنك لا تعلم إلا إطار عمل واحد، أي أن الأمر يتعلق بالأداء، و لذلك ففي البداية يفضل أن تبقى على إطار عمل واحد حتى تتقنه ثم يمكنك تعلم إطار آخر.1 نقطة
-
جانغو ليست مناسبة في الحالات التالية: تطبيقك ضخم للغاية ، ولا يمكنك الاحتفاظ بكل شيء في قاعدة بيانات واحدة. تطبيقك أساسي ، اي لا يتطلب قاعدة بيانات أو أي شيء معقد . تريد بناء كل شيء من البداية ، وأنت تعرف ما تفعله اما بالنسبة لتعلم اكثر من اطار العمل ، بالتأكيد من الصواب فعل ذلك ، لان اطر العمل ليست الا ادوات للعمل بها وكل اداة لها مكانها المحدد وكل اداة لها ايجابياتها وسلبياتها1 نقطة
-
يمكنك إستعمال المواقع التي تقوم بإزالة الخلفية بشكل تلقائي عبر الذكاء الإصطناعي، هنا بعض هذه المواقع: remove.bg removal.ai pixlr remove background retoucher.online ويمكنك الوصول لمواقع أكثر من خلال البحث في جوجل على "Remove Background from Images".1 نقطة